Pull Panda (integrated into GitHub Code Review) review and pricing

Acquired by GitHub in 2019, core features integrated into native code review.

By GitHub · Founded 2018 · San Francisco, CA · public

Pull Panda was a dedicated GitHub code review automation product (Pull Reminders, Pull Analytics, Pull Assigner) founded 2018 that GitHub acquired in August 2019. After the acquisition GitHub integrated the core features into native Code Review and made them free for all GitHub users, then sunset the standalone Pull Panda product. As of 2026 there is no standalone Pull Panda buyer experience, Pull Reminders functionality lives inside GitHub Pull Requests scheduled reminders, code-owner assignment, and Slack notifications; Pull Analytics functionality lives inside GitHub Insights and the GitHub REST API metrics endpoints. We list it here for buyers searching for the historical product so they understand the current path: do not buy Pull Panda separately, configure the equivalent inside GitHub. Strengths today: free as part of GitHub, native to the platform, no second invoice. Trade-offs: depth of the original Pull Panda product has not been fully recreated (Pull Analytics is thinner than the original), and buyers wanting modern PR automation should consider Mergify or Graphite.

Trust signal log
  • 2019-08-15
    GitHub acquired Pull Panda
    Acquisition was clean and well-received; core features integrated into GitHub Code Review and made free for all users.
  • 2020-03-01
    Standalone Pull Panda product sunset
    Pull Reminders, Pull Assigner, Pull Analytics absorbed into native GitHub; standalone product no longer buyable.
  • 2024-09-22
    Pull Analytics depth thinner than original
    Some original Pull Panda customers report regression in workflow features; analytics shallower than the standalone product.
